The Unforgettable Final: A Battle of Titans
The Argentina World Cup 2022 win was sealed in arguably the most dramatic final the tournament has ever witnessed. Facing a formidable France, led by the electrifying Kylian MbappĂ©, Argentina found themselves in a fierce battle. The match started brilliantly for Argentina, with Lionel Messi converting a penalty and Ăngel Di MarĂa adding a stunning second goal. It looked like a comfortable victory was on the cards. But football, as we know, is a game of unpredictable twists and turns. France roared back in the second half, with MbappĂ© scoring two goals in quick succession to level the score, sending shockwaves through the stadium and the millions watching worldwide. Extra time ensued, and the tension was unbearable. Messi once again put Argentina ahead, only for MbappĂ© to complete his hat-trick from the penalty spot, forcing a penalty shootout. The sheer drama of it all was almost too much to comprehend. In the shootout, the Argentine players showed incredible mental fortitude. Emiliano MartĂnez, the hero of the penalty shootout against the Netherlands, once again made crucial saves, while his teammates calmly converted their spot-kicks. The decisive moment came when Gonzalo Montiel stepped up and slotted home the winning penalty. The eruption of joy that followed was immense. It was the culmination of a lifelong dream for Messi and a historic moment for Argentine football. This final was a true display of skill, resilience, and the sheer will to win. Celebrating a Nation's Dream Fulfilled
The Argentina World Cup 2022 win sparked celebrations unlike anything seen in recent memory. As the final whistle blew and Montiel's penalty hit the back of the net, a wave of pure elation washed over Argentina. Cities and towns across the country transformed into scenes of jubilation, with millions pouring into the streets, waving flags, singing anthems, and embracing strangers in a shared moment of national ecstasy. The iconic Obelisco monument in Buenos Aires became the focal point for the celebrations, thronged by ecstatic fans who partied for days. The players, upon their return, were treated as national heroes, greeted by an estimated four million people in Buenos Aires â a record-breaking reception that highlighted the profound impact of their achievement.
